Key Factors Influencing Daily Weather
Bridgeport's daily weather is a complex interplay of several geographical and atmospheric elements. Its position on the coast of Long Island Sound is paramount. The Sound acts as a moderating force, often leading to milder winters and cooler summers right along the coastline compared to inland areas. However, this proximity also exposes Bridgeport to unique weather phenomena.
Wind patterns, for instance, are heavily influenced by the land-sea breeze effect. During warmer months, a refreshing sea breeze often develops in the afternoon, providing relief from the heat. In colder seasons, winds off the Sound can make already cold temperatures feel even more biting due to the wind chill factor. High humidity levels are also common, particularly during the summer, which can make even moderate temperatures feel oppressive.

Short-Term vs. Long-Term Predictions
Short-term forecasts, typically covering the next 24-72 hours, are highly detailed and generally quite accurate. They provide specific hourly breakdowns of temperature, precipitation chances, wind gusts, and even cloud cover. These are invaluable for daily planning, such as deciding what to wear or if you need an umbrella.
Long-term forecasts, extending from a week out to several months (seasonal outlooks), focus on general trends and probabilities. They indicate whether temperatures are likely to be above or below average, or if precipitation will be higher or lower than normal. While less specific, these outlooks are vital for agricultural planning, resource management, and understanding broader climate patterns.
The Science Behind Forecasting in a Coastal City
Forecasting for a coastal city like Bridgeport presents unique challenges and requires specialized models. Meteorologists use numerical weather prediction (NWP) models, which process vast amounts of atmospheric data from satellites, radar, and weather stations. For coastal areas, these models must accurately account for interactions between land and sea, including sea surface temperatures, coastal topography, and the formation of localized weather systems like sea fog or coastal fronts.
Our analysis shows that factors such as the position of the jet stream, the strength of high and low-pressure systems moving across the continent, and the specific dynamics of the Long Island Sound all critically influence the weather in Bridgeport. Specialized mesoscale models are often employed to capture these smaller-scale phenomena that larger global models might miss. It's also important to remember that even with advanced technology, forecast accuracy can decrease with time due to the chaotic nature of the atmosphere. Reputable sources like the National Weather Service (NWS) provide detailed discussions on forecast uncertainty, offering a transparent view of potential variations.
The Unique Climate of Bridgeport, Connecticut
Bridgeport's climate is classified as a humid continental climate, but with significant maritime influences from Long Island Sound. This unique blend results in distinct seasonal variations that define life in the city.
Seasonal Weather Patterns Explained
- Spring (March-May): Generally mild with increasing temperatures, but highly variable. Early spring can see late-season snow or cold snaps, while late spring brings pleasant warmth. Precipitation is common, and the blooming of flowers signals the end of winter's chill. Our experience indicates spring is a transition phase, often requiring layers of clothing due to fluctuating temperatures.
- Summer (June-August): Warm to hot and humid. Average daily temperatures often range from the mid-70s to low 80s Fahrenheit, with occasional heatwaves pushing into the 90s. The humidity, driven by moisture from the Atlantic Ocean, can make these temperatures feel significantly warmer. Thunderstorms are frequent, especially in the late afternoons.
- Autumn (September-November): Pleasant and often considered the most beautiful season. Temperatures gradually cool, humidity drops, and foliage bursts into vibrant colors. Indian summer periods can extend the warmth well into October. Nor'easters, while more common in winter, can sometimes impact the region in late fall.
- Winter (December-February): Cold, with a mix of rain, freezing rain, and snow. Average temperatures hover around freezing. Snowfall can be significant, particularly during nor'easters, which are intense coastal storms. The proximity to the Sound can mean less snow right on the immediate coast, but also greater chances of freezing rain or sleet. According to NOAA climate data, Bridgeport typically experiences several significant snow events each winter.
Coastal Influences and Microclimates
Bridgeport's location on Long Island Sound creates distinct microclimates. Areas directly along the waterfront often experience slightly milder temperatures than inland neighborhoods due to the moderating effect of the Sound's waters. Preparing for Bridgeport's Diverse Weather Events
Given the varied weather in Bridgeport, preparedness is not just recommended; it's essential. From heavy snowfall to intense summer heat and potential coastal storms, being ready can mitigate risks and ensure safety.
Navigating Winter Storms and Nor'easters
Bridgeport winters can bring significant snow and ice, often delivered by powerful nor'easters. These storms can cause widespread power outages, hazardous road conditions, and coastal flooding. Effective preparation includes:
- Emergency Kit: Stock up on non-perishable food, water, flashlights, batteries, and a first-aid kit.
- Vehicle Preparedness: Ensure your car has a full tank of gas, emergency blankets, shovel, and sand/salt for traction.
- Home Winterization: Seal drafts, insulate pipes, and have an alternative heating source if possible. The Connecticut Department of Energy and Environmental Protection (DEEP) often provides guidance on preparing homes for winter conditions.
- Stay Informed: Monitor NWS advisories and local news for snow emergencies and travel bans. In our practical experience, residents who plan ahead face significantly fewer disruptions.

Severe Thunderstorms and Coastal Flooding Risks
Summer also brings the threat of severe thunderstorms, which can produce damaging winds, hail, and flash flooding. Coastal flooding is a particular concern for Bridgeport, especially during high tides combined with heavy rainfall or storm surges from tropical systems.
- Flood Preparedness: Know if your home is in a flood zone. Have a plan to evacuate if necessary. Never drive or walk through floodwaters.
- Thunderstorm Safety: Seek shelter indoors immediately during a thunderstorm. Avoid open fields, tall trees, and water bodies.
